A Castle in Jaén for the price of a luxury apartment in Ibiza

Andalusian village has palace for sale that costs the same as one of the island's exclusive homes

The real estate portal Idealista offers among its advertisements the sale of a castle in Espeluy (Jaén) for 1.5 million euros, the same as the cost of a luxury home on the island , with much less square footage and less history. This property was declared an Asset of Cultural Interest in 1985.

Its origin dates back to the caliphate period, since in this location a Muslim castle was located on this site, as published by Idealista. It was owned in 1224 by Fernando III. In 1321 a new castle was built and in 1469 it was taken by the troops of Don Miguel Lucas de Iranzo. At the end of the 18th century, beginning of the 19th century, it was built as a Christian castle.

The total area of the plot is 4,800 square meters of which 3,720 square meters are destined to stables, corrals and common areas and 1,120 square meters correspond to the building.

The part of the house consists of two floors: in the upper part there are seven bedrooms and seven bathrooms and in the lower part there is a cellar, a large stable, storage rooms and a house for the castle guard.

Keep

Its most genuine element is its magnificent keep, with a square floor plan, in whose interior two superimposed rooms covered by barrel vaults are preserved. The access gate and the wall surrounding the castle is an addition of the current owners.

The Espeluy Castle is located 35 kilometers from Jaén; one hour and 20 minutes from Granada; one hour from Córdoba; and two hours and 20 minutes from Málaga and Seville.

“It is an ideal place as an investment with infinite possibilities as it could be developed as a tourism product in the area: either as a boutique hotel, the headquarters of a large winery, as an equestrian club or even an oil mill because it is surrounded by a sea of beautiful olive trees,” explains the real estate agent selling the property.
